Pros & cons summary


Recency 18 April 2017 12 January 2021
Maximum RAM amount 8 GB 6 GB
Chip lithography 14 nm 8 nm
Power consumption (TDP) 185 Watt 60 Watt

RX 580 XTR has a 33% higher maximum VRAM amount.

RTX 3060 Max-Q, on the other hand, has an age advantage of 3 years, a 75% more advanced lithography process, and 208% lower power consumption.

We couldn't decide between Radeon RX 580 XTR and GeForce RTX 3060 Max-Q. We've got no test results to judge.

Be aware that Radeon RX 580 XTR is a desktop graphics card while GeForce RTX 3060 Max-Q is a notebook one.
